Delft University of Technology

Delft University of Technology (TU Delft) is the oldest and largest public technical university in the Netherlands and a member of the 4TU.Federation. Its programmable footprint is narrow, and this profile states that plainly rather than padding it. TU Delft operates exactly one public, unauthenticated API: the 4TU.ResearchData repository at data.4tu.nl, which runs on djehuty, open-source repository software written by 4TU.ResearchData and Nikhef. The /v2 surface is deliberately shape-compatible with the Figshare v2 API because that was a requirement of the 2023 migration OFF Figshare — the contract is not Figshare's, and the service runs inside TU Delft's own RIPE netblock (DUNET, 131.180.0.0/16). The other genuinely institution-operated machine-readable surface is a SAML 2.0 identity provider at login.tudelft.nl, published into the SURFconext national federation and onward to eduGAIN. Beyond those two, the picture is retirement and tenancy. The general-purpose institutional API platform at api.tudelft.nl — campus, buildings, courses, schedules, study results, organisation — no longer answers on port 80 or 443, and its documentation host apidoc.tudelft.nl has no DNS record at all. The research information portal at pure.tudelft.nl / research.tudelft.nl is an Elsevier Pure tenancy whose own API documentation canonicalises to api.elsevierpure.com: TU Delft's data, Elsevier's contract. The library discovery layer is an OCLC WorldCat tenancy. No working OAI-PMH endpoint exists on any TU Delft-operated host despite third-party registry entries claiming otherwise. TU Delft publishes no OpenAPI, no llms.txt, no scope vocabulary and no API changelog.
